Capito Commences Construction on New Health Department Building

U.S. Senator Shelley Moore Capito (R-W.Va.), Ranking Member of the Senate Appropriations Subcommittee on Labor, Health and Human Services, Education, and Related Agencies (Labor-HHS), recently attended the groundbreaking ceremony for the new Hardy County Health Department in Moorefield. The project, funded by Capito in 2023, aims to develop a new health department and Food Service Training Facility to cater to the needs of the growing community. It will enhance medical services, expand food service options, and provide educational opportunities to residents.

Capito highlighted that Hardy County, a rapidly growing area in West Virginia, is a beacon for the state. The collaborative effort between federal, state, and local levels has made this project possible. The new health department will address the health, food service, and educational needs of the community in Hardy County. Capito expressed her pride in supporting this initiative and anticipates its positive impact on the region.

Mallie Combs, Executive Director of the Hardy County Rural Development Authority, commended Capito for her continuous support and understanding of community needs. The partnership with Senator Capito has been fruitful for the development of Hardy County, and her presence at the groundbreaking ceremony was appreciated.

In May 2023, Senator Capito secured a $474,000 loan from the U.S. Department of Agriculture (USDA) Rural Development Grant Program to contribute to the construction of the new health facility in Moorefield. This funding will play a crucial role in bringing the project to fruition and improving the overall healthcare services and educational opportunities available in Hardy County.
